Biography
I have always had a deep care for children, which initially led me to become an elementary school teacher and a special education teacher. With over 35 years of experience in family law, I have assisted individuals through challenging times including divorce, custody battles, parenting time disputes, decision-making conflicts, relocation issues, child support matters, domestic violence cases, and guardianship issues. I am committed to continually deepening and broadening my knowledge and skills in the family law field. I am adaptable to your needs and can assist you at any stage of the process. Contingent Fees
Contingency fees based on results is ethically forbidden in the family law area. -
